# Break-Glass Access — CarSim Dispatch Sandbox

For external plugin authors only. Break-glass applies when the CarSim elevator-dispatch simulator's plugin sandbox wedges and normal restart fails. Steps: notify the on-call maintainer, file an incident stub, then invoke the emergency unlock endpoint from the admin shell. Access is logged and reviewed weekly. Abuse revokes your plugin signing rights. The unlock prompt will ask for the recovery passphrase below.

unlock words, yawig-kagef: gordor-holvan-ulaael-pramir-ulaiel-tamdor

Minutes — Management Meeting, Korvell Systems

Attendees: D. Marsh, P. Ilenko, R. Quade. Topic: outsourcing tier-one support to Bravenor Desk Services. Projected saving of 18% against current staffing costs in Halden Bay. Transition window: six weeks. Severance provisions reviewed and approved. Finance to model cash impact by Friday. The strategic rationale is set out in the note below.

confidential, kagap-yagef: The finance team signed off on a budget of $467.8 million for Project Aldok.

# Break-Glass: Catalog Cache Invalidation

Scope: the Pinrow product catalog at Veldstone Retail. If stale prices persist after a purge and the Hollowmere invalidation queue is wedged, use break-glass to flush the edge tier directly. Contractors: get verbal sign-off from the catalog lead first. Steps: open the Hollowmere admin shell, select emergency-flush, confirm the tenant, and run it once — repeated flushes thrash the origin. Access is logged and expires after 20 minutes. Unseal the admin shell with the passphrase below.

recovery phrase for kahop-tajog: istix-casvan

**Leadership Review Briefing — New Commission Scheme**

Board, here's the short of it: the old flat-rate commission at Tollbridge Instruments was rewarding easy renewals and ignoring hard-won new accounts. The revised scheme tilts payouts toward new business and multi-year deals, capped sensibly so nobody games it. Early modelling suggests payroll cost stays roughly neutral while behaviour shifts where we want it. The confidential planning detail sits just below.

board note of kagep-yahig: Only 9 of the 120 pilot accounts renewed Quenix, so a churn review is set for April 1.